一段数字的短时能量怎么求

如题所述

求一段数字的短时能量方法如下:
1、将原始信号分帧:将原始信号按照固定的时间间隔分为若干个帧,通常每个帧的长度为10毫秒至30毫秒之间。这里的帧长需要根据实际情况选择,一般来说帧长越长,短时能量的计算粒度就越大,对信号变化的响应就会越慢。帧长越短,短时能量的计算粒度就越小,对信号变化的响应就会越快。
2、对每个帧进行加窗:将每个帧乘以一个窗函数(如Hamming窗)以减少边缘效应。
3、计算每个帧的能量:将每个帧内的所有样本平方加和即为该帧的能量。
4、对每个帧的能量进行归一化处理:为了消除帧长对能量大小的影响,可以将每个帧的能量除以帧长的平方根。
5、将每个帧的能量按时间顺序拼接起来,即得到整段信号的短时能量曲线。
温馨提示:答案为网友推荐,仅供参考